BackgroundBereavement profoundly impacts caregivers, especially adult children who lose a parent. Grief may become complicated when cultural, relational, and spiritual conflicts remain unresolved. Rituals rooted in local tradition can serve as powerful psychospiritual interventions, yet they remain underutilised in mainstream palliative bereavement care.Case PresentationWe describe the case of a 32-year-old unmarried man who developed severe grief-related distress following the death of his 60-year-old mother from metastatic ovarian carcinoma. As her sole caregiver and emotionally dependent companion, he experienced intrusive images of her suffering, guilt, insomnia, anorexia, and inability to work. He also expressed a culturally rooted fear that his mother's soul remained in distress, creating profound spiritual dissonance. The Brief Grief Questionnaire (BGQ) score was 9 out of 10, indicating high risk for complicated grief. His bereavement occurred during Diwali, intensifying a sense of incompleteness in shared rituals of light and remembrance. Conventional counselling offered minimal relief, as his grief was anchored in unaddressed cultural-spiritual obligations. A culturally informed intervention, the Pāyā Śhrāddha ritual in Odisha, was recommended to provide symbolic fulfilment of filial duty and spiritual release. Following the ritual, he reported significant emotional relief, cessation of intrusive imagery, restored sleep, and functional recovery. His BGQ score improved from 9 to 3, remaining stable at 6-week follow-up.ConclusionThis case highlights the therapeutic power of culturally grounded rituals in addressing grief sustained by spiritual-moral conflict. Integrating indigenous practices such as Pāyā Śhrāddha into bereavement care can promote meaning-making, resolve guilt, and support recovery where conventional counselling alone may be insufficient. Culturally responsive, ritual-aware approaches should be recognised as vital components of holistic palliative care.
Major head and neck oncologic surgeries cause significant systemic inflammation, with elevated CRP and IL-6. Vitamin C may help reduce perioperative inflammation and improve hemodynamic stability. In this double-blind study, 60 ASA I–II adults scheduled for elective head and neck cancer surgery with flap reconstruction were randomized to receive either intravenous vitamin C (Group C, n = 30; 1 g in 100 mL preoperatively, pre-incision, and before extubation/weaning) or placebo (saline, Group S, n = 30). Serum CRP and IL-6 were measured preoperatively and on postoperative days 1 (POD1) and 4 (POD4). The primary outcome was the serum CRP level on POD1, representing the early postoperative inflammatory response. Secondary outcomes included CRP on POD4, IL-6 levels at POD1 and POD4, vasopressor use, analgesic requirements, postoperative complications, and lengths of ICU and hospital stay. Baseline demographics and preoperative inflammatory markers were similar across groups. On POD1, the mean CRP and IL-6 levels were lower in the vitamin C group compared to placebo (CRP 7.6 ± 1.8 vs. 12.7 ± 6.5 mg/dL, p = 0.001; IL-6 43.3 ± 11.4 vs. 62.2 ± 21.5 pg/mL, p = 0.041). By POD4, these values showed no significant differences. No significant differences were observed in ICU stay, vasopressor use, analgesic requirements, or postoperative complications. However, hospital stay was significantly shorter in the vitamin C group. Perioperative vitamin C reduced early postoperative inflammatory markers, but the effect was transient. The shorter hospital stay observed in the vitamin C group requires confirmation in larger studies.
BACKGROUND:Thymoma is the most common anterior mediastinal neoplasm in adults and often requires surgical resection for curative treatment. Traditional approaches, including open surgery and multiportal thoracoscopic techniques, are associated with significant morbidity. The uniportal subxiphoid approach offers a minimally invasive, patient-friendly alternative, with potential benefits in operative efficiency and post-operative recovery. This technique may be particularly advantageous in low-resource settings, given its simplicity and reduced need for specialized equipment or personnel. METHODS:This study included 27 patients who underwent uniportal subxiphoid thymectomy at our institution between January 2022 and December 2024. The technique involves pre-operative planning based on tumour staging, with resections possible for tumours up to 15 cm. The patient is placed supine, with no carbon dioxide insufflation or epidural anaesthesia used. An incision below the xiphoid process provides access for tumour dissection, utilizing a thoracoscope. The thymoma is carefully removed through the incision, followed by a mediastinal drain placement. RESULTS:In 27 patients, tumour sizes ranged from 2 to 15 cm. The mean operative time was 106.9 min, with minimal blood loss (46.7 mL). All procedures were R0 resections, with no conversions to open surgery. Post-operative pain was minimal, and the mean hospital stay was 2.6 days. CONCLUSIONS:The uniportal subxiphoid thymectomy is an effective, minimally invasive technique, offering excellent outcomes in terms of operative time, blood loss, and recovery. It provides a safe, efficient, and cost-effective alternative, especially for low-resource settings.
339 Background: Inpatient mortality in palliative care units ranges 10-30% globally, yet prognostic data from low- and middle-income countries (LMICs) remain limited. Whether admission-day clinical and laboratory variables can identify high-risk patients in resource-limited settings is unclear. Methods: Retrospective analysis of a prospectively maintained database from two inpatient palliative care wards at a tertiary cancer centre in North India. All consecutive index admissions (January-December 2025) were included. Primary outcome: terminal event (inpatient death or discharge for end-of-life home-based care). Predictors: ECOG performance status, admission reason, number of complaints, serum albumin, haemoglobin, estimated glomerular filtration rate, total leukocyte count, age, sex, weekend admission, cancer type, distance. Multivariable logistic regression with stepwise selection identified independent predictors. Sensitivity analysis examined mortality alone. Results: Among 1,458 patients (mean age 52.3±14.1 years, 51% male), terminal events occurred in 275 (18.9%) and deaths in 182 (12.5%). Multivariable analysis retained 6 independent predictors (Table). ECOG PS 4 showed strongest association (OR 42.3). Symptom-based predictors included dyspnoea (OR 33.8), delirium (OR 23.3), and symptom complexity with ≥3 complaints (OR 17.1). Laboratory markers included severe renal impairment (OR 3.3) and albumin (OR 0.55 per g/dL, protective). Weekend admission was associated with increased risk (OR 2.5). Sensitivity analysis using mortality alone yielded consistent findings. Conclusions: Basic admission day variables can reliably forecast terminal outcomes among palliative care inpatients. ECOG PS, initial symptoms, albumin, and kidney function, all accessible at the bedside without advanced tests, help guide triage, care planning, and resource distribution in LMICs. The results encourage early prognosis discussions and care preparation. Independent admission-day predictors of terminal event in palliative care inpatients (n=1458). Predictor OR (95% CI) P-value ECOG PS 4 (vs 1-2) 42.3 (17.8 - 100.6) <0.001 Dyspnoea (vs pain) 33.8 (8.7 - 132.1) <0.001 Delirium (vs pain) 23.3 (5.9 - 92.6) <0.001 ≥3 complaints (vs 0-1) 17.1 (3.5 - 83.2) <0.001 Severe CKD (vs normal) 3.3 (1.8 - 6.1) <0.001 Weekend admission 2.5 (1.4 - 4.4) 0.002 Albumin (per g/dL) 0.55 (0.39 - 0.76) <0.001
Interventional pain management plays a pivotal role in addressing distressing symptoms, notably pain, in palliative care patients with locally advanced rectal cancer. Ganglionic impar block and caudal epidural block have emerged as promising approaches for refractory pain relief. This case report discusses a 61-year-old female with locally advanced rectal cancer experiencing severe perianal pain, unresponsive to high-dose opioids. The patient underwent ganglion impar and caudal epidural block, resulting in a significant reduction in pain intensity. However, she developed transient confusion postprocedure, which resolved spontaneously within 2 h. This unusual complication underscores the importance of meticulous technique and patient monitoring in interventional pain management. While rare, transient neurological symptoms following such procedures necessitate understanding their potential etiologies and effective management strategies. This case highlights the efficacy of interventional pain management in rectal cancer-associated pain and emphasizes the need for continued research to optimize patient outcomes in cancer pain management.

BackgroundParents caring for children with cancer face substantial physical, emotional, social, and financial challenges, especially in low- and middle-income countries like India.ObjectiveIn this study, we aimed to assess caregiver burden and quality of life among parents of children with cancer in the Indian context, and to describe the socio-cultural and economic factors influencing these outcomes.MethodsIn this cross-sectional study, 200 primary caregivers of paediatric oncology patients were assessed using the Zarit Burden Interview (ZBI), WHOQoL-BREF, and the Multidimensional Scale of Perceived Social Support (MSPSS). Socio-demographic and clinical data were collected through interviews and review of medical records.ResultsThe median ZBI score was 66 (IQR 23.5), with 66% of caregivers experiencing severe burden. Caregiver burden was higher among mothers, caregivers with lower education, those unemployed, and those living in nuclear families. Burden negatively correlated with duration of illness (r = -0.75, P < 0.05) and quality of life across all domains. Perceived social support was low, particularly among caregivers living alone or in nuclear families.ConclusionsHigh caregiver burden and impaired quality of life were observed among caregivers in a resource-limited setting. Strengthening social support and implementing family-centred interventions may help reduce the burden and improve outcomes.
Objectives:Burnout is a significant occupational hazard among palliative care physicians, driven by the emotionally demanding and high-stress nature of their work. Despite its implications for physician well-being and patient care, limited data are available on burnout within Indian palliative care settings. This study aimed to assess the prevalence of burnout and explore associated demographic and occupational factors among palliative care physicians across India. Materials and Methods:A cross-sectional survey was conducted among 68 palliative care physicians across India using a non-probabilistic convenience sampling approach. Participants completed a semi-structured socio-demographic questionnaire along with the Copenhagen Burnout Inventory (CBI), which measures burnout across three domains: personal, work-related and client-related. Given the non-normal distribution of data, non-parametric statistical tests were employed for analysis. Results:The majority of physicians (85.3%) reported low overall burnout, whereas 10.3% experienced moderate burnout and 4.4% reported high burnout, based on established CBI cut-off scores. Notably, higher work-related and client-related burnout scores were observed among junior physicians and those practising in mixed-care settings. Engagement in regular physical activity was significantly associated with reduced overall burnout (P = 0.039), indicating its potential protective effect. Conclusion:Although most palliative care physicians in India demonstrated low levels of burnout, a significant minority exhibited moderate to high burnout-particularly in domains related to work and patient care. These findings highlight the need for targeted interventions aimed at improving institutional support, encouraging physical well-being and optimising work environments to mitigate burnout and enhance the sustainability of palliative care practice.
Perineal pain in patients with pelvic malignancies, such as rectal cancer, can be debilitating and significantly impair quality of life. The ganglion impar block (GIB) is an established interventional technique for managing such pain. However, anatomical changes following pelvic radiotherapy, particularly sacrococcygeal fusion, may render conventional approaches to GIB ineffective or unsafe. We report the case of a 41-year-old male with locally advanced rectal cancer and radiation-induced sacrococcygeal fusion who presented with severe, refractory perineal pain. Pain was poorly controlled despite systemic opioids and adjuvant analgesics, and conventional trans-sacrococcygeal GIB attempts under fluoroscopy failed due to the inability to traverse the fused joint. A novel coaxial transosseous technique was employed. A large-bore (21G) needle was used in a rotatory fashion to drill through the ossified sacrococcygeal joint. Subsequently, a 27G spinal needle was introduced coaxially through the first needle, facilitating precise placement and administration of therapeutic agents under fluoroscopic guidance. The patient reported significant and sustained pain relief. Post-procedure, the patient experienced substantial pain reduction (Numerical Rating Scale 8/10 to 2/10), improved defecation-related symptoms, and enhanced functional status. No procedural complications were observed. Follow-up at one week confirmed ongoing analgesic benefit with reduced opioid requirements. The coaxial transosseous GIB is a safe, effective, and innovative technique for managing refractory perineal pain in patients with radiation-induced sacrococcygeal fusion. It offers a viable alternative when conventional approaches fail and warrants further evaluation through prospective studies.
BACKGROUND:Nasotracheal intubation (NTI) is particularly challenging in patients with rigid neck or micrognathia. Advancements in video laryngoscopy may improve NTI outcomes. We compared performance of direct laryngoscope (DL), King Vision videolaryngoscope (KVL), and C-MAC videolaryngoscope (VL) in normal, rigid neck, and micrognathia airway. METHODS:A randomized, self-controlled crossover trial was conducted with 20 anesthesiologists who performed NTI on a high-fidelity mannequin under three airway conditions. Device order was randomized using a computer-generated sequence, and outcome assessors were blinded to the sequence of devices used. Primary outcomes were time to glottic view and intubation. Secondary outcomes included ease of intubation and force on incisors. RESULTS:The median difference (95%CI) in time to intubation suggested that CMAC was better than KVL in normal airway (-9.0[-13.0 to-6.0], p < 0.001), rigid neck (-12.0[-18.0 to -6.5], p < 0.001) and micrognathia (-16.5[-20.0 to -13.5], p < 0.001). When compared to DL, CMAC was better for micrognathia (-8.0[-5.5 to-10.5], p = 0.001) but comparable for normal airway and rigid neck. C-MAC also exerted the least force on incisors, minimizing dental trauma. CONCLUSION:The C-MAC VL demonstrated superior performance across all airway conditions, offering faster, safer, and easier NTI, making it the preferred device in challenging scenarios. Background and Aims: Traditional airway assessment methods likely miss findings, resulting in unanticipated difficult airways. Surgeons routinely do computed tomography (CT) scans of head and neck cancer patients to determine the extent and resectability of the disease. We used these images for 3-dimensional CT (3D CT) reconstruction to provide additional airway-related information to the anaesthesiologist and studied its impact on airway management. Methods: We randomly allocated 60 patients into two groups to formulate the airway management plan: Group A (Conventional airway assessment) and Group B (Conventional airway assessment along with 3D CT findings). A CT reporting format was prepared based on a literature review after discussion with radiologists and airway experts. In the case of luminal obstruction, a virtual endoscopy video was also created. These findings were shown to the anaesthesiologist managing the airway, and any change in the primary plan was noted. The primary outcome was the total time required for successful airway management. Secondary outcomes included the number of attempts, number of alternative techniques, other manoeuvres required, incidence of failed intubation, and any complications. Data were analysed using the SPSS statistics software. Results: The airway management time between both groups was comparable, with a median difference of 0 [95% confidence interval (CI): −14, 20; P = 0.752]. Among the manoeuvres used, optimal external laryngeal manipulation (OELM) was required more in Group A ( P = 0.007). Both groups had no difference in the number of attempts ( P > 0.99), number of alternative techniques ( P = 0.052), and complications ( P > 0.99). There was a significant change in the endotracheal tube size after CT findings were shown ( P < 0.001). It aided in selecting the preferred side of the nostril for nasotracheal intubation (kappa = 0.545, showing moderate agreement between before and after CT groups). As per the feedback from anaesthesiologists who rated 3D CT on a Likert scale, it was considered beneficial for airway assessment. Conclusion: 3D CT reconstruction and virtual endoscopy can be a valuable method of airway assessment.
Patients with inoperable hepatobiliary cancers often endure severe abdominal pain, which impacts their quality of life. This pain is usually a combination of both nociceptive and neuropathic pain, which necessitates a comprehensive multimodal approach for effective management. Splanchnic nerve plexus block (SNB) has shown promising results in this regard. This case series reviews the literature and clinical practices, exploring the potential benefits of early SNB in the palliative care of patients with hepatobiliary cancers. We describe three cases illustrating SNB's potential in achieving notable pain relief. Each patient reported a pain reduction from 10/10 to less than 1/10, a reduced requirement for opioids and sustained relief at a 1-month follow-up. This case series suggests the potential role of SNB in select patients with ongoing oncology therapy for alleviating severe pain, decreasing opioid requirements and potentially enhancing overall functional status.
BACKGROUND:Postoperative pulmonary complications (PPCs) are defined heterogeneously and have major adverse effects in increasing morbidity. Oncosurgeries themselves are complex, are of long duration, and extensive handling of body tissues occurs in them, leading to various complications including PPCs. So, we conducted this prospective study intending to find the incidence and risk factors for PPCs in patients undergoing major oncosurgeries. METHODS:This prospective observational study was conducted after obtaining institutional ethical approval in patients undergoing major oncosurgeries. The demographic, preoperative, and intraoperative details were noted, and patients were followed in the postoperative period for the occurrence of PPC till discharge. Assess Respiratory Risk in Surgical Patients in Catalonia (ARISCAT) score was used to predict the occurrence of PPC. Data were analyzed using multivariable regression analysis for the risk factors, and the Chi-square trend was used to see the trend of PPC with the change in ARISCAT score. RESULTS:The overall incidence of PPC in patients undergoing major oncosurgeries was 28.05%. The most common PPCs were respiratory insufficiency (19.2%) and atelectasis (17.6%). The highest incidence of PPC was found in thoracotomies (41.6%), followed by cytoreductive surgeries (40.6%). The risk factors for PPCs included body mass index (BMI) <18.5 or >25 kg/m2, smoking, use of nasogastric tube, age >60 years, and albumin <3.5 g/dL. Patients with low ARISCAT scores had a low incidence of PPC compared to those with high and intermediate ARISCAT scores. CONCLUSION:The incidence of PPC in patients undergoing major oncosurgeries was 28.05% in our study. The independent risk factors for PPC in oncological surgeries were BMI <18.5 kg/m2 or >25 kg/m2, use of nasogastric tube, age <60 years, serum albumin <3.5 g/dL, and smoking.
Pancreatic cancers have a poor prognosis and generally present with uncontrollable pain. Thermal radiofrequency ablation (RFA) is a safe and effective technique that can be employed in this subset of patients. It has been proven that it is a minimally invasive technique that can be performed under fluoroscopy technique with local anesthesia. Thus, it helps in the better palliation of suffering patients. Especially in patients where the coeliac plexus cannot be targeted due to encasement, the splanchnic nerve can be targeted easily. Here is reported a case in which pancreatic cancer pain was successfully managed with thermal RFA.
There is a paucity of literature regarding the effect of anesthetic techniques on antitumor immunity, especially in gall bladder malignancies. We designed a study to compare the effect of propofol-based total intravenous anesthesia and sevoflurane-based general anesthesia-on antitumor immunity, including tumor growth factor-β (TGF-β), T-helper cell profile, and inflammatory markers. A pilot prospective randomized trial was conducted in 64 patients undergoing surgery for gall bladder malignancy under general anesthesia in a tertiary specialty cancer hospital. Adult cancer patients of ASA physical status I-III fulfilling the inclusion criteria were randomized to either group S (sevoflurane-based general anesthesia) or group T (propofol-based total intravenous anesthesia). Preoperative (morning of surgery) and postoperative (24 h and 1 month after surgery) blood samples were obtained. Demographic profile and preoperative parameters were comparable between both groups. There was a statistically significant difference in the postoperative value of TGF-β (higher in group T). There was a statistically significant difference in postoperative interleukin-17A value (indicative of TH17 cells), and it was found to be higher in group S. Propofol-based TIVA increases serum TGF-β levels. At the same time, Sevoflurane modulates T-helper cells-based immunity to increase TH17 cells in patients with gall bladder cancer. Multiple larger studies will be required to validate the results and provide useful recommendations.
Background: Patients with primary brain tumors navigate a distinct illness trajectory, characterized by an uncertain prognosis, a rapid decline in physical functioning, and a significant deterioration in the quality of life. These unique challenges underscore the importance of our research in understanding and addressing the needs of these patients. Methods: The EORTC QLQ C30 & EORTC BN 20 questionnaires assessed the quality of life and symptom burden in patients with primary brain tumors. The scores were analyzed using SPSS statistical software. Results: 100 patients - 61 males and 39 females—were included with radiological or histopathological diagnoses of primary brain tumours. Seizures (38%) was the most common presenting symptom, followed by headache (18%), loss of consciousness (13%), focal neurological deficit (9%), and blurring of vision (8%). The mean quality of life at baseline was 78.29, with a standard deviation of 9.67 on a scale of 0 to 100, and the brain tumor-specific symptom burden score was 46.9, with a standard deviation of 17.95 on a scale of 0 to 100. There was a significant difference in the global health status score between the first and third visits at 3 months ( P value = .03). Conclusion: Despite the aggressive and often incurable nature of primary brain tumors, there is hope in the form of palliative care. By addressing unmet symptoms, uncertainties about the future, and social functioning, palliative care can significantly improve the quality of life of these patients.

Purpose To assess the End of life care (EOLC ) practices and the magnitude of futile care in a tertiary cancer center. To find out the barriers in provision of good EOLC in cancer patients. Methods An observational study was done on 129 patients. Patients were enrolled using the palliative prognostic index (PPI) in the end of life stages. Socio-demographic and clinical details were recorded. Detailed counselling done by the palliative physician or the oncologist was recorded. The barriers in provision of care were recorded. Results In this study initial experience of 129 patients were analyzed. PPI score was > 6 (survival shorter than 3 weeks) in 85 (65.89%) ; 34 (26.36%) had PPI score between > 4 to 6 (survival between 3 to 6 weeks); and 10 (7.75%) patients had PPI score less than equal to 4( survival more than 6 weeks).77 (59.69%) patients preferred home as their place for EOLC while 41(31.78%) preferred hospital, 7 (5.43%) preferred hospice while 4 (3.10%) opted ICU for their EOLC. The most common barrier associated was caregiver related in 34 case, followed by physician related in 14 cases and patients related in 3 cases, because of hope of being cured in hospital, social stigma, fear of worsening of symptoms at home, denial. Conclusion EOLC is the least studied part of patient care with various barriers. With proper communication and a good palliative care support, futile treatment can be avoided. With healthy communication we can empower family members and patients for a good EOLC.
BACKGROUND:Existing literature lacks high-quality evidence regarding the ideal intraoperative positive end-expiratory pressure (PEEP) to minimize postoperative pulmonary complications (PPCs). We hypothesized that applying individualized PEEP derived from electrical impedance tomography would reduce the severity of postoperative lung aeration loss, deterioration in oxygenation, and PPC incidence.METHODS:A pilot feasibility study was conducted on 36 patients who underwent open abdominal oncologic surgery. The patients were randomized to receive individualized PEEP or conventional PEEP at 4 cmH2O. The primary outcome was the impact of individualized PEEP on changes in the modified lung ultrasound score (MLUS) derived from preoperative and postoperative lung ultrasonography. A higher MLUS indicated greater lung aeration loss. The secondary outcomes were the PaO2/FiO2 ratio and PPC incidence.RESULTS:A significant increase in the postoperative MLUS (12.0 ± 3.6 vs 7.9 ± 2.1, P < 0.001) and a significant difference between the postoperative and preoperative MLUS values (7.0 ± 3.3 vs 3.0 ± 1.6, P < 0.001) were found in the conventional PEEP group, indicating increased lung aeration loss. In the conventional PEEP group, the intraoperative PaO2/FiO2 ratios were significantly lower but not the postoperative ratios. The PPC incidence was not significantly different between the groups. Post-hoc analysis showed the increase in lung aeration loss and deterioration of intraoperative oxygenation correlated with the deviation from the individualized PEEP.CONCLUSIONS:Individualized PEEP appears to protect against lung aeration loss and intraoperative oxygenation deterioration. The advantage was greater in patients whose individualized PEEP deviated more from the conventional PEEP.
